Luis Valenzuela was born in Guadalajara, Mexico. He moved to Canada in 2001, beginning his career at North 44 restaurant under renowned chef Mark McEwan.

He apprenticed much of the time under Executive Chef Andrew Ellerby, and attributes much of his knowledge and passion to this experience.

Luis also worked under renowned Italian Chef Bruno Barrbieri in Verona, Italy, and with Chef Adolfo Munoz from Toledo, Spain. His career so far has shaped him as the Chef of Café Cinquecento in 2006, and today Luis is one of the youngest accomplished Chefs of the city, running the kitchen of Torito Tapas Bar in Kensington Market since 2007.

Recently just opened and Co-own a Spanish restaurant focusing on paellas and tapas. Carmen Cocina Espanola.

Enroute Magazine nominated Carmen as one of the best new restaurants in Canada for 2013.
